Android Companion App via BLE: Architecture & Implementation
Overview
Add an Android companion application that communicates with CYD boards via Bluetooth Low Energy (BLE) while preserving the existing ESP-NOW synchronization between the two CYD boards.

Key Architectural Decisions (ADRs)
ADR
Decision
Rationale
ADR-001
Retain ESP-NOW for CYD↔CYD
Already implemented, encrypted, offline-capable
ADR-002
BLE for Android↔CYD
Both boards verified BLE; Android native BLE APIs
ADR-003
Shared C++ core via JNI/NDK
Single authoritative game/protocol implementation
ADR-004
Explicit packet serialization
No struct memory layout dependence
ADR-005
Spectator mode first
Validate transport before multi-writer sync
ADR-006
CYDs remain authoritative
Boards work offline when phone disconnects
ADR-007
BLE over BT Classic
GATT model, low power, notifications
System Architecture
[Android Phone] <---> BLE GATT <---> [CYD Host/Gateway] <---> ESP-NOW <---> [CYD Peer]
^ ^
Kotlin + C++ Core (shared)
Jetpack Compose (JNI on Android)
Phased Implementation Plan
Phase 1: Core Extraction & Protocol Hardening
Extract platform-neutral C++ logic into core/ (protocol, packet, serializer, reconciliation, active_game, mastermind, puzzle, aquarium)
Remove Arduino/ESP32 dependencies from core
Define explicit packet serialization (replace raw struct memcpy)
